Job Description

Job Summary

The Senior Marketing Specialist position will partner closely with marketing team members and the larger Retirement Segment team on the successful building of strategy and delivery of marketing material campaigns presentations and communications. This position is responsible for developing and delivering insightdriven content and projects that align with overall messaging goals of the organization.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Produce insightdriven content to communicate effectively to our target audiences.
  • Understand and maintain an indepth understanding of F&Gs product suite and fit in the sales process in order to differentiate our products and help sales effectively engage with financial professionals
  • Write and edit content (e.g. presentations collateral emails etc. that ladders up to our overall vision and goals.
  • Maintain and update existing content. Identify pieces impacted by a product or rate change create and execute a plan to address.
  • Maintain collateral list to analyze and easily identify pieces based on usage product key message etc.
  • Drive consistency across all related content and materials.
  • Support other marketing team members content development handling of collateral pieces (workflow testing ensuring live on time).
  • Contribute to the discovery and development of marketing briefs and campaign plans.
  • Work with the team to monitor analyze and report on campaign results as well as make recommendations on how to adapt strategies and tactics based on data.
  • Assist in continuously improving marketing best practices helping establish a dataled marketing culture that drives revenue.
  • Lead development and of event strategies in collaboration with the Corporate Events and Sales teams.
  • Determine event efficiencies build content decks and agendas ensure highlevel F&G experience for guests analyze reporting and build recommendations to optimize.
  • Manage webinars and tradeshow strategy from planning to and reporting.
  • Manage speaker list for IMO and FI channel events. Partner with Corporate events on vetting sponsorship agreements and list maintenance. Build & execute strategy behind industry partner sponsorships (e.g. IRI LIMRA).Serve as primary relationship liaison with Index and Bank partners.

Experience and Education Requirements

  • Bachelors degree in marketing journalism business analytics or a related field required.
  • 35 years of experience in marketing in financial services industry. Specific experience in B2B marketing a plus.
  • 3 years of event experience required

About F&G

Since 1959 Fidelity & Guaranty Life Insurance Company (F&G) has offered annuity and life insurance products to those who are seeking security in retirement and protection during lifes unexpected events.
